From 3a23e188e4ad0cb959ed9eb02036c3772bfe2718 Mon Sep 17 00:00:00 2001 From: Jakob Date: Wed, 22 Feb 2023 13:59:22 +0100 Subject: [PATCH] ci: adds release-please integration for easier release generation --- .github/workflows/default.yml | 11 +++++++++++ version.txt | 1 + 2 files changed, 12 insertions(+) create mode 100644 version.txt diff --git a/.github/workflows/default.yml b/.github/workflows/default.yml index f8a5adb..479e9ce 100644 --- a/.github/workflows/default.yml +++ b/.github/workflows/default.yml @@ -15,3 +15,14 @@ jobs: - name: Run commitlint uses: wagoid/commitlint-github-action@v5 + + release-please: + needs: lint + runs-on: ubuntu-latest + if: github.ref == 'refs/heads/main' + steps: + - uses: google-github-actions/release-please-action@v3 + with: + token: ${{ secrets.AUTERION_CI_ACCESS_TOKEN }} + release-type: simple + package-name: auterion-pre-commit-hooks diff --git a/version.txt b/version.txt new file mode 100644 index 0000000..8acdd82 --- /dev/null +++ b/version.txt @@ -0,0 +1 @@ +0.0.1